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Delphi Mehrsprachige Anwendung (https://www.delphipraxis.net/60819-mehrsprachige-anwendung.html)

kobel 12. Jan 2006 16:39


Mehrsprachige Anwendung
 
Hallo,

bin von Delphi6 auf Delphi 2006 umgestiegen.

Bisher habe ich meine Anwendungen mit der Komponente TMultilang mehrsprachig realisiert.
(das ging auch sehr gut)

Leider läuft diese Kompo nicht mehr unter Delphi 2006.

Ich wollte nun die die Sprachfunktionalität von Delphi 2006 nutzen,
bisher jedoch leider ohne Erfolg.
(Projekt->Sprache->neu Sprache)

Wenn ich nach der Anleitung in der Hilfe vorgehe komme ich zu einem leeren Übersetzungseditor.

Was mache ich falsch ?
oder ist von dieser Methode abzuraten ?!

Danke für ne Info !
kobel

Niko 12. Jan 2006 17:44

Re: Mehrsprachige Anwendung
 
Hi,

du machst wahrscheinlich gar nichts falsch, sondern musst nur noch die passende Resourcendatei über die Projektverwaltung öffnen: Unter Projektname.SPRACHE die *.dfm Dateien, für die Übersetzung der Formulare oder die *.rc Dateien für die Übersetzung von Stringkonstanten.

Bernhard Geyer 13. Jan 2006 07:13

Re: Mehrsprachige Anwendung
 
Zitat:

Zitat von kobel
Bisher habe ich meine Anwendungen mit der Komponente TMultilang mehrsprachig realisiert.
(das ging auch sehr gut)

Leider läuft diese Kompo nicht mehr unter Delphi 2006.

Was geht nicht? Falls Du Sourcen hast sollte es kein Problem darstellen das Package so anzupassen das es auch mit D2006 lauffähig ist.

kobel 13. Jan 2006 07:26

Re: Mehrsprachige Anwendung
 
Den Sourcecode habe ich leider nicht.
Ich habe aber gestern mit dem Entwickler der TMultilang gesprochen und er sagte, er wolle mir den Code senden.

Bisher leider noch nicht !

Bernhard Geyer 13. Jan 2006 07:29

Re: Mehrsprachige Anwendung
 
Zitat:

Zitat von kobel
Den Sourcecode habe ich leider nicht.
Ich habe aber gestern mit dem Entwickler der TMultilang gesprochen und er sagte, er wolle mir den Code senden.

Bisher leider noch nicht !

Kommt hoffentlich noch.
Generel sollte man als Delphi-Entwickler immer darauf Achten die Sourcen für alle eingesetzten Komponenten zu haben. Kostet zwar ein paar € mehr aber man hat dann bei weiten weniger Problem bei Versionwechsel Delphi wenn die Hersteller "zicken" oder es sie schon gar nicht mehr gibt.

Der Jan 13. Jan 2006 07:31

Re: Mehrsprachige Anwendung
 
Ich kenn TMultiLang nicht, deshalb diese Frage: Was ist an dieser Komponente so gut, das man dafür soviel Kohle zahlt? Soll keine kritik sein, echt nur ne Frage.

kobel 13. Jan 2006 07:50

Re: Mehrsprachige Anwendung
 
In Delphi 6 gab es meines Wissens (Unwissen) das Sprachtool nicht.
So bin ich auf TMultilang gekommen.
Ist meiner Meinung nach auch sehr komfortabel: Komponente auf Form legen -> CSV-File exportieren -> in EXCEL übersetzen und zurück importieren. Man kann in der laufenden Anwendung die Sprache wechseln.

Bin aber für andere Möglichkeiten offen !

Der Jan 13. Jan 2006 07:52

Re: Mehrsprachige Anwendung
 
Ich könnte GNU gettext for Delphi empfehlen... Ist sogar kostenlos :)


Alle Zeitangaben in WEZ +1. Es ist jetzt 03:12 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z